The factors that influence decision-making in dealing with girls at 19 include societal expectations, individual values, peer influence, and educational background. Societal expectations play a role in shaping the behavior and choices of individuals. For example, cultural expectations about dating and relationships may influence how a 19-year-old girl perceives the importance of having a boy-friend or girl-friend.

Individual values also play a significant role in decision-making. Personal beliefs and principles can guide a person's choices when dealing with girls at 19. For instance, if someone values independence and self-reliance, they may make decisions that prioritize their own goals and aspirations.

Peer influence is another important factor. Friends and peers can have a strong impact on decision-making, especially during adolescence. For example, a 19-year-old girl may feel the need to conform to her peer group's standards or make choices based on what her friends are doing.

Educational background can also shape decision-making. Different levels of education and exposure to various subjects can influence how a person approaches decision-making and problem-solving. For instance, a 19-year-old girl with a strong science background may rely on analytical thinking when making decisions.
